Red Web Offender Spray

Offender ID™ is a police accredited tagging system designed for use by security professionals. Using redDNA™, the portable spray device ensures that criminals can be identified even if they flee the crime scene.

How it Works

OffenderID offers a portable form of RedWeb's redDNA™ technology. The small canister can be attached to clothing ready for use.

 

If an offender is caught committing a crime and the security officer is unable to apprehend them, the officer can spray the offender with offender ID. This marks them with redDNA™ dye, making it easier for pursuing officers to identify the criminal as well as providing evidence to link them irrefutably to the crime scene. The offender ID spray can also be deployed for self defence, as spraying the criminal can both distract and deter them.

 

We provide a four hour training course offering guidance on safe and appropriate use of offender ID which all security personnel must complete before being supplied with the product. This is essential as it ensures that use of the device meets the police guidelines for their Secured by Design initiative.

 

The Training

This 3-4 hour training session leads to accreditation for registration to use the hand-held redweb™ Offender I.D. spray.

 

Training sessions can be held in classroom type environments, although some room will be required for the practical instruction.

 

Aims:

To teach delegates about the practical use of the redweb™ Offender I.D spray in self-defence and crime prevention incidents.

 

Objectives:

By the end of the session delegates will be able to;

Understand how the redweb™ product works to identify offenders;

Explain the relevant laws regarding its use;

Identify the basic component parts of the hand-held device;

Show a practical understanding of how to use the device in stressful situations;

Understand the importance of proper justification and reporting

 

This session will use a mixture of presentation techniques including lectures, Powerpoint presentations, practical demonstrations and question and answer sessions.
